Centro di Acquisizione ed
Elaborazione Dati (CAED)
Giuseppe Mendicino, Giuseppe De Marco,
Andrea Luci, Alfonso Senatore
Arcavacata di Rende 22 Febbraio 2013
UNIVERSITÀ DEGLI STUDI DELLA CALABRIA
WP 6.1 – Acquisizione dati: architettura del sistema
Attività Elementare
AE 6.1.1 Analisi delle WSN
presenti in letteratura
AE 6.1.2 Supporto alla scelta
dei dispositivi
Inizio
Fine
Stato
01/02/2012
29/02/2012
Terminata
29/02/2012
Terminata
01/02/2012
AE 6.1.3 Modalità invio dati
01/03/2012
31/03/2012
Terminata
AE 6.1.4 Modalità
connessione e scambio dati
01/04/2012
30/04/2012
Terminata
AE 6.1.5 Testing piattaforma
acquisizione WSN
01/03/2012
31/12/2012
Da prolungare
AE 6.1.6 Architettura CAED
01/02/2012
31/12/2012
Terminata
AE 6.1.7 Trattamento dei dati
01/05/2012
31/12/2012
Da modificare
AE 6.1.8 Event Log System
01/04/2012
31/12/2012
Terminata
AE 6.1.5 – Testing piattaforma acquisizione WSN
OR 3
Simulatore
OR 5
OR 6
OR 2
TD
Group
WSN
Laboratorio
OR 2
Artese
OK
OR 2
Strago
OK
OR 3
UNIFI
AE 6.1.5 – Testing piattaforma acquisizione WSN
Nodo Coordinatore
WsnLAB
AqSink
AqServ
LewisDB/CAED
Firmware Realizzato:
Processi implementati:
1. Radio ZigBEE
1. AqSink, client di AqServ,
2. Frammentazione
comunicazione in protocollo
Messaggio
TCP/IP
3. Sensori Puntuali
2. ZBFetcherSender, comunica
4. Recupero Messaggi
con la WSN in protocollo
5. Ricezione Comandi Remoti
ZigBee
AqServ:
1. Servizio di Acquisizione dei
Dati dai nodi concentratori
delle WSN;
2. Mediatore tra le reti di
monitoraggio e la base dati
LewisDB
Modalità di Comunicazione: TCP/IP Socket Stream
Scambio Asincrono dei messaggi
Multipiattaforma
AqServ
Formato JSON per invio messaggi
Alert di carattere tecnico (acquisizione)
Formato
JSON dei Messaggi
{
'hops': '1,2,3,4', 'sink_insert_datetime': '2013-03-12 14:44:50',
'message': '[0013A200408C9D03 13-3-6 12:9:52 #sample] x:26,y:6,z:985 -int_temp:26.2 -bat:65\n ; '
}
Invio Comandi CAED to WSN
•Scambio comandi attraverso AqServ
•Formato di tipo JSON
•Attesa di ricezione della conferma dal Sink
AE 6.1.5 – Testing piattaforma acquisizione WSN
Simulatore
OK
OR 3
UNIFI
OK
OR 3
OR 5
OR 6
OR 2
Strago
?
?
OR 2
Artese
?
OR 2
TD
Group
?
OK
?
WSN
Laboratorio
Registrazione dei dispositivi e dei sensori all’interno di LEWIS
Compilazione del modulo MRD013
• Definizione dello staff di lavoro (riferimenti)
• Definizione dei dispositivi (end-device, nodo concentratore, nodo coordinatore)
• Definizione dei sensori (accelerometro, termometro, radar, scatterometro, ecc.)
Dispositivo/Sensore Registrato:
1. Invio dei dati
2. Scambio Messaggi CAED /
WSN
3. Validazione del CAED dei
messaggi
MRD013
LewisDB
Dispositivo/Sensore NON
Registrato:
1. Nessun Scambio dati con il
CAED
MODULO: MRD013
Staff di Competenza
Gruppo di Lavoro o Società di Appartenenza
Referente tecnico (Nome e Cognome)
Data Compilazione
Email
Contatto Telefonico
Ogni Staff che si occupa della
rete di monitoraggio deve
produrre e mettere a
disposizione del CAED il
modulo MRD013 compilato.
Scheda da replicare per ogni dispositivo
Tipo Dispositivo
Identificativo Univoco
Prodotta da
Ogni rete di monitoraggio
Nome Modello
avente n dispositivi deve
essere corredata da n schede Versione Software/Firmware
di registrazione di dispositivi. Modelli sensori montati
Coordinate di Posizionamento
Operante in WSN (Nome Rete)
MODULO: MRD013 – SCHEDA DISPOSITIVI
Tipo di Dispositivo
• End Device, Router, Coordinatore, Gateway, Sink.
Identificativo univoco
• Mac Address
Prodotto Da
• Indicare il produttore (nel caso di dispositivo acquistato) o lo staff
nel caso di dispositivo prodotto da un’attore del progetto
Nome Modello
• Nome del modello del dispositivo (e.g. Waspmote)
Versione Software/Firmware
• es. CAED 0.5
Modelli Sensori Montati
• Lista di sensori che sono operativi nel dispositivo (LIS3LV02DL,
SHT75)
MODULO: MRD013 – SCHEDA SENSORI
Produttore Hardware
Scheda da replicare per ogni sensore
Prodotto da
•Accelerazione
•Spostamenti/Velocità
•Livello di Falda
•Potenza Retrodiffusa
• ecc.
Tipo di Misurazione
%, g, °C, mm, m
Unità di Misura
Modello
Nome del modello
(LIS3LV02DL,
SHT75)
Variabili della Misurazione
Range Acquisizione
Link web datasheet
[-20;80]; [0;1000]; [-2024;2024]
x,y,z; temp; prec; h_fald
http://URL
AE 6.1.7 – Trattamento dei Dati
Sensori Puntuali: trattamento dei dati ed inserimento all’interno della Base Dati
delle acquisizioni dei sensori puntuali
Acquisizione
Estrazione
Validazione
Archiviazione
Procedura Testata con la rete di Laboratorio
Sensori Areali: in corso di definizione da parte dell’ OR 3 del formato dei dati
?
1.
Dati Grezzi
2.
Dati Elaborati
3.
Dati Puntuali o Array di Dati
?
?
WP 6.1 – Acquisizione dati: architettura del sistema
Attività Elementare
Inizio
Fine
Stato
AE 6.1.5 Testing piattaforma
acquisizione WSN
01/03/2012
01/06/2013
Prolungata
AE 6.1.6 Architettura CAED
01/02/2012
31/12/2012
Terminata
AE 6.1.7a Trattamento dei dati
(sensori puntuali)
01/05/2012
01/06/2013
Prolungata
AE 6.1.7b Trattamento dei dati
(sensori areali)
01/04/2013
01/09/2013
Da Aggiungere
AE 6.1.8 Event Log System
01/04/2012
31/12/2012
Terminata
AE 6.1.9 Acquisizione
Integrazione e Test
01/07/2013
01/10/2013
Da Aggiungere
Test della piattaforma di Acquisizione con tutte le reti
di monitoraggio del progetto
WP 6.2 – Elaborazione Dati
Attività Elementare
Inizio
Fine
Stato
AE 6.2.1 Sviluppo del sistema
di analisi e validazione dati
01/06/2012
01/10/2013
Da sdoppiare
AE 6.2.1 Sviluppo del sistema
di analisi e validazione dati
(sensori puntuali)
01/06/2012
01/10/2013
In corso
AE 6.2.2 Sviluppo del sistema
di analisi e validazione dati
(sensori areali)
01/04/2013
01/10/2013
Non Iniziata
AE 6.2.3 Sviluppo del sistema
di consultazione dei dati
01/06/2012
01/10/2013
In corso
AE 6.2.4 Integrazione con i
modelli di preannuncio
01/04/2012
01/10/2013
Non Iniziata
AE 6.2.5 Test Sistema
01/07/2013
01/10/2013
Non Iniziata
AE 6.2.1 – Sviluppo del sistema di analisi e validazione dati
(Sensori Puntuali)
Nodo Coordinatore
AqServ
AqSink
Creazione Oggetto
AqMessage
Validazione
Header:
[0013A200408C9D8C 2013-03-04 10:42:00 #sample]
Content:
-x:77.76,y:85.00,z:81.41 -temp:22.6 -bat:52%
Header
Content
True
False
Header Extraction Rules
1. Validazione identificativo di rete
Tabella Dinamica
SI
Validazione
NO
1. Orfano
2. Evento
Tabella: Orfans
NO
1. Recuperabile
2. Evento
Tabella: Recoverables
NO
1. Recuperabile
2. Evento
Tabella: Recoverables
Schema Messages
Tabella: w1_id-MAC
Tabella: w2_id-MAC
SI
2. Validazione datetime
Validazione
3. Validazione tipo messaggio
Messaggio
Autenticato
SI
Validazione del Content
Validazione
Content Extraction Rules
4. Validazione sample e watch
Tabella Dinamica
SI
Valori
Coerenti
NO
1. Evento
Schema Acquisitions
Tabella: w1_id-MAC_TipoMisura_Variabili_TipoMessaggio
Tabella: w2_id-MAC_TipoMisura_Variabili_TipoMessaggio
…
5. Validazione Status, Ack, Response, Warning
Tabella Dinamica
SI
Valori
Coerenti
NO
1. Evento
Schema Acquisitions
Tabella: w1_id-MAC_TipoMessaggio
Tabella: w2_id-MAC_TipoMessaggio
…
FINE: Validazione del Messaggio TERMINATA
Unità Geomorfologiche
monitorate (UGM)
Cosenza
Unità Geomorfologiche
non monitorate (UG)
Per ogni tratto autostradale da monitorare
Definizione delle Unità Geomorfologiche
1.
2.
3.
4.
5.
Nome dell’Unità Geomorfologica
Descrizione
Estensione
Bbox dell’Unità
Relazione con il TAS
Relazione Dataset TAS
Altilia
Sub Unità Geomorfologica
Per ogni unità geomorfologica n Sub Unità
Geomorfologiche
Relazione con la Unità Geomorfologica
Eredita la relazione con il TAS ed il dataset per
la rappresentazione su WebGIS
Relazione con il TAS
Relazione
Dataset TAS
Relazione con le Reti di Monitoraggio
Identificazione se la UG è monitorata (UGM) o
non monitorata (UG)
Classificazione Sub Unità Geomorfologiche
Unità Geomorfologiche (UG)
Sub Unità Geomorfologiche (SUG)
Classificazione delle tipologia franosa
secondo standard
(Crudens & Varnes, 1996) – (AGS, 2002)
Caratteristiche geometriche delle frane rappresentative delle Sub Unità Geomorfologiche
1.Larghezza superficie di rottura
2.Lunghezza superficie di rottura
3.Profondità superficie di rottura
4.Direzione della superficie di rottura
1. Velocità di spostamento della frana
2. Tipologia di movimento
3. Tipologia del materiale: roccia, terra, detrito
4. Stato di Attività: attivo, riattivo, quiescente, inattivo …
5. Distribuzione dell'Attività: avanzante, retrogressiva, allargamento …
SCUG – Sistema di Controllo delle Unità Geomorfologiche
Relazione
Sub Unità Geomorfologiche
Reti di Monitoraggio
Modello di Intervento
Modelli di Preannuncio
WSN 1
WSN 2
Tipo
Nome
URL
Regionale
Trigrs, Geotop
http://URL
Locale
SUSHI, Sciddica
http://URL
Esecuzione e controllo dei modelli
in remoto
Formato dei dati e validazione/elaborazione Sensori Areali
• Formato dei dati per inserimento in LewisDB
• Definizione di algoritmi per estrarre il contenuto informativo ai fini dell’Early
Warning
• Rappresentazione degli output dei sensori areali (CAED)
Test Piattaforma di Acquisizione con gli altri attori del progetto
• Compilazione modulo MDR013
• Test con nodo concentratore delle varie tipologie di reti (CAED + Reti OR 2, 3, 5)
Integrazione dei modelli di preannuncio (OR 4) in LEWIS
• Definizione degli input/output dei modelli
• Gestione in remoto dei modelli
• Eventuali test di verifica da condurre da parte del CAED
Sistema di allerta (WP 8.1) per l’attivazione dei livelli di criticità
• Procedure per l’attivazione dei livelli di criticità
• Scambio messaggi con il CCC (CAED + CCC)
Scarica

Elaborazione Dati